Description

Learn about eastern philosophy, mysticism, meditation, and ancient Chinese culture while opening to self-discovery by reading and discussing two books that shed light on Lao Tzu?s Tao Te Ching. The first book, Nine Nights with the Taoist Master, weaves a translation of the Tao Te Ching into a novel set in ancient China. The story places Lao Tzu in a turbulent border city where, at the prince?s invitation, he spends nine nights with the prince, scholars, traders, courtiers, and monks explaining the secrets of the Tao?s power. The second book, Tao: The Way of God, talks about the power of the universe, the spiritual dimension, and breaking beyond the limits or our man-made artificial world. Instructor Catherine Lange began studying in 1973 with the author of both books?Master Waysun Liao, who studied with a wandering Taoist in a Taoist temple in Taiwan until he became a full Tai Chi and Tao master. Course fee covers the cost of the book. Covers the spiritual Wellness dimension.
